The one you sign is the marriage license. That then gets sent to the state where they produce on official marriage certificate.
You need the certificate for AOS.

I entered the US on a K3 visa in April 2006. I went to the Melbourne DMV in Florida in May 2006. I showed up with my passport, K3 visa, Ontario drivers license and birth certificate. They took my Canadian (Ontario) license and gave me a Florida license which expires April 2008 (same date as when my K3 visa expires). They told me once I get my NOA for AOS I can bring it in and they will extend my license to the standard issue. Not really sure how long that is but probably 2-5 years.
They didn’t say anything about only being able to drive for 6 months. You can only stay in the US for 6 months though so maybe that’s where they were going with that. They did take away my Ontario license tough. Said it was illegal to have 2 licenses.
